What has been improved? 

  • Some of the new elements that we expect to improve our spam catch rate include:

    • A poison detection mechanism to ignore irrelevant text in a mail.

    • Character visual normalization. For example, including a "0" instead of an "o" won't fool SpamTitan.

    • Enhanced IP, domain and URL reputation checks.

    • Enhanced attachment filtering.

    • Image filtering with Optical Character Recognition (OCR), logo and facial analysis technologies.

    • Phone number filtering.

    • Cryptocurrency wallet filtering.
